Fast service, great prices, and really tasty stick-to-the-belly food is the perfect description for this popular family-owned restaurant, located a few blocks from U.S. 52, and an easy drive from I-40.   This restaurant brings back memories of earlier days when take-out joints had seating patterns of stools lined against the wall, where you could eat and look out the window to watch the traffic and people passing by. Daily specials change often, but Char's offers a wide variety of menu choices, which is not bad for a local operation.  As the name implies, the hamburger is the main attraction, but you can go for fish, hot dogs, and other selections as well.  The ice cream comes from the same machine as the milkshakes, and they taste pretty darn good, too!    If you wait too long to get your order, the staff will offer you a free drink, ice cream or milkshake on the house!  Char's wants your business, and they appreciate seeing you again and again!    Hours: 10 a.m. to 10 p.m. daily, and noon to 7 p.m. on Sundays...please call for exact times.

Two locations in Winston-Salem, with competitive prices to any other supermarket chain around!   Open from 9 am to 7 pm daily.  Friday: 9 am to 8 pm.  Sunday: Noon to 6 pm.

The map has marked the wrong position for this ALDI store: It is on West Hanes Mill Road, which is several blocks from U.S. 52. The store sits behind a tire and automotive center on the corner of University Parkway and West Hanes Mill Road, next to the North Forsyth High School campus (off Shattalon Drive).

Phone number is unlisted - ALDI has stores worldwide!  You will love their prices!   Since ALDI saves you money at the checkout, you can bring your own boxes and bags to place your items in!   Or you can leave your bags at home, and buy ALDI paper bags for a nickel apiece, ALDI regular plastic bags for 10¢ each, or the giant insulated bags (for wet and cold items) for $1.00.   If you want to use one of the shopping carts, simply place a quarter in the chain-release slot, and return it to the storage area when done to get your quarter back!

The second ALDI store in Winston-Salem is at 2715 Peters Creek
Parkway, ZIP 27127.  The business hours at this location are the same!

Now moving towards a second year of business as a convenient take-out restaurant, Hot Dog City is surprisingly affordable and delicious.  The menu,  which definitely features all-beef dogs, also offers customers many other selections besides the signature food, and prices are easy on the wallet.  Satisfaction is always guaranteed, and the cooks will prepare your order just the way you like it!  You have to try the half-pound jumbo dog, with prices starting around $5.00 -- believe me, this huge dog will take care of your stomach better than a regular meal!   All during the day, customers from all over town, including the lunchtime crowds from the dairy plant across the street, stop here to get their fill.  Hot Dog City is located at the traffic light on the corner of Glenn and Patterson Avenues in one of Winston-Salem's most-historic black neighborhoods.   Visit them sometimes...and buy one of their beef or turkey dogs for a buck and a few pennies, fixed any way you like it!  Business Hours: 10 am to 9 pm, Monday through Thursday; 10 am to 11 pm on Fridays; and 11 am to 11 pm on Saturdays.  Hot Dog City will give your taste buds a treat!
